Notes and recommendations
-Wash by hand with water removing all clay or mud, towel dry and leave to air dry.
-Do not leave your tools submerged in water or soaked.
-When using the tool on the lathe, you can submerge it in the water in the basin to clean it but then leave it out, do not leave it floating.
-Do not use chemicals or abrasives.
-Apply mineral oil and beeswax ointment or other special wood oil occasionally.
-For occasional maintenance you can use very fine sandpaper 320+ and ointments or special natural oils for wood, let the product dry 24h before use.
-If at any time you notice that the wood is rougher than you like after the first use or at later times, you can gently sand the surface with fine sandpaper 320+ and reapply protection for a smoother finish to the touch. This aspect does not affect the proper functioning of the tool.
-The final product may have slight variations in color and wood grain due to the use of a natural raw material.
